Western blot analysis of extracts from Jurkat (lane2(20μg), Hela (lane3(20μg),Neuro-2a (lane4(20μg) and HepG2 (lane5(20μg) using BCAT1 Antibody (HY-P88129). Proteins were transferred to a PVDF membrane and blocked with 5% non-fat milk in TBST for 2 hour at room temperature. The primary antibody (1/1000) and Loading control antibody (Beta Actin, HY-P80993, 1/10,000) was used in 5% non-fat milk in TBST at 4°C overnight. Goat Anti-Mouse IgG-HRP Secondary Antibody (HY-P8004 ,1/10,000) was used for 1 hour at room temperature.

Immunohistochemical analysis of paraffin-embedded human glioma tissue using BCAT1 Antibody (HY-P88129, 1/500). The section was pretreated using heat mediated antigen retrieval with sodium citrate buffer (pH 6.0) for 8 minutes. The tissues were blocked with quick block buffer for 0.5 hours at room temperature, washed with PBS and PBST, and then incubated with the primary antibody overnight at 4℃. The detection was performed using an HRP conjugated compact polymer system. DAB was used as the chromogen. Tissues were counterstained with hematoxylin and mounted with DPX.

Background
-
Function
BCAT1 catalyzes the first reaction in the catabolism of the essential branched chain amino acids leucine, isoleucine, and valine
-
Subcellular Localization
Cytoplasm
-
Expression
Tissue_Specificity: During embryogenesis, expressed in the brain and kidney. Overexpressed in MYC-induced tumors such as Burkitt's lymphoma -
